Transponder Keys

Transponder keys use a microchip that transmits a signal into the car's computer system. This signal contains unique data that helps identify the key. The chip is activated when the key is placed in close proximity to the vehicle, which allows you to open the doors and trunk and start the engine. These keys are far safer than conventional metal keys, making them more difficult to steal.

Modern cars are usually equipped with an anti-theft immobilizer. This prevents the vehicle from starting if the incorrect key is used. If the immobilizer system is not functioning properly, it will not respond to the signal generated by the transponder chip. This can be a big problem, especially if you put your keys inside your car. Keyless Entry Remotes

Hyundai owners can control a variety of functions with their key fob. For instance it's possible to enable the feature that automatically folds the side-view mirrors after the driver turns off the ignition. Another feature lets drivers push a button on their key fobs to open the boot. This is helpful when parking in tight spaces. In addition the key fob could also activate the rear cargo camera.

If your key fob won't work, first ensure that it's got a new battery. The procedure of replacing the Hyundai key fob battery is usually easy. If you're having difficulties pairing the new fob with your vehicle, it might be beneficial to consult the owner's manual. Certain vehicles require you to use a programming software, while others offer on-board methods to pair key fobs via the infotainment or dashboard controls.

Most of the time, key fobs operate on the 315 MHz or 433 MHz frequency spectrum. They employ digital encryption to transmit their unique codes. The vehicle's receiver receives an RF signal, and then verify the code. It then responds accordingly.
